Agre'ment South Africa celebrates 50th year anniversary and certificate handover

Public Works and Infrastructure Deputy Minister Noxolo Kiviet in partnership with Agre'ment South Africa cordially invites you to the 50 year anniversary and certificate handover ceremony to mark its existence and innovation excellence.

Agre'ment South Africa is an implementing entity for Public Works and Infrastructure tasked with the testing and performance of built industry products and methodologies to ensure quality and durability on behalf of Government. The entity was launched as a fully-fledged legal entity of the Department in 2018 following a proclamation by the President in March 2017. The event will be held at the CSIR International Convention centre, Pretoria, on 4th October 2019 at 08:00 - 14:00. The entity is at the forefront in spearheading new innovations in the built industry aimed at providing advancement in the construction industry in compliance with the core principles environmental sustainability, cost saving methodologies and quality. The entity has approved and certified a number of significant innovations and technologies that have contributed towards the development of the country and its stature as a world class entity of government.
